Ingredients Overview

Here’s what makes these wraps delicious and customizable. You can easily tweak them based on dietary needs or what you have on hand.

Cooked Chicken

Shredded or diced chicken breast works best — grilled, rotisserie, or even leftover roast chicken. It should be tender and juicy, ready to soak up the flavor of the sauce.

Substitutes:

  • Grilled tofu or tempeh for a plant-based option

  • Ground chicken or turkey for a different texture

  • Crispy chicken tenders or breaded cutlets for a crunchier bite

Sweet Chili Sauce

This vibrant sauce is the star of the wrap. It’s tangy, mildly spicy, and sweet, commonly made from red chili peppers, vinegar, garlic, and sugar.

Tip: For a homemade version, combine rice vinegar, garlic, sugar, red pepper flakes, and cornstarch. For less heat, mix with a bit of mayo or Greek yogurt.

Tortilla Wraps

Large flour tortillas are ideal for easy rolling and holding all the fillings. You can also use whole wheat, spinach, or low-carb wraps.

Other options:

  • Lettuce leaves for a lighter version

  • Rice paper for an Asian-style summer roll

Fresh Vegetables

Crisp veggies bring freshness and crunch. Common choices include:

  • Shredded carrots

  • Julienned cucumber

  • Sliced red bell peppers

  • Shredded cabbage or coleslaw mix

  • Leafy greens (romaine, spinach, or arugula)

Optional Fillings & Toppings

  • Avocado slices – creamy texture

  • Chopped peanuts – for crunch

  • Fresh cilantro or mint – for herbal brightness

  • Green onions – for sharp contrast

  • Lime wedges – to squeeze over before rolling

Creamy Base (Optional)

To balance the sweet chili heat, add:

  • Plain Greek yogurt

  • Cream cheese

  • Hummus

  • Spicy mayo or garlic aioli

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Prepare the Chicken

If using fresh chicken breast, season lightly with salt and pepper, and either grill, bake, or pan-sear until fully cooked (internal temp of 165°F). Let it rest, then slice or shred.

For even faster prep, use shredded rotisserie chicken or leftovers from a previous meal.

2. Toss with Sauce

Place the warm chicken in a bowl and toss it with sweet chili sauce until fully coated. Let it sit for a few minutes to soak up the flavor.

Optional: Heat the sauced chicken in a skillet for a warm, sticky glaze.

3. Prep the Veggies

Slice your veggies thinly so they lay flat in the wrap. Wash and dry lettuce or greens thoroughly to prevent sogginess.

4. Warm the Wraps

Warm tortillas on a skillet for 10–15 seconds per side or microwave under a damp paper towel for 20 seconds to make them more pliable and easier to fold.

5. Assemble the Wraps

Lay a tortilla flat. Spread a thin layer of your creamy base (if using). Add a generous scoop of sweet chili chicken, then top with veggies, herbs, and any extra toppings.

6. Roll and Serve

Fold in the sides, then roll tightly from the bottom up. Slice in half on a diagonal if desired. Serve warm or chilled, with extra sweet chili sauce on the side.

Tips, Variations & Substitutions

Helpful Tips

  • Don’t overfill: Too many ingredients will make the wrap hard to roll and prone to tearing.

  • Use a firm wrap: Soft, pliable tortillas prevent cracks and help hold everything together.

  • Serve chilled or warm: Great both ways depending on your preference or the season.

Variations

  • Thai-Inspired: Add chopped peanuts, shredded coconut, or a peanut-lime drizzle.

  • Asian Slaw Wraps: Replace lettuce with coleslaw mix tossed in rice vinegar and sesame oil.

  • Spicy Version: Mix in Sriracha, chili crisp, or red pepper flakes for extra heat.

Dietary Swaps

  • Low-Carb: Use lettuce leaves or low-carb tortillas.

  • Gluten-Free: Choose certified gluten-free wraps or rice paper.

  • Dairy-Free: Skip the creamy base or use a plant-based alternative.

Nutritional & Health Notes

These wraps offer a solid balance of protein, fiber, and healthy fats — especially if you add avocado and fresh greens. Sweet chili sauce does contain sugar, so you can control sweetness by mixing it with yogurt or cutting it with lime juice.

To make them more nutrient-dense:

  • Use whole grain wraps

  • Load up on colorful vegetables

  • Choose grilled chicken over fried

  • Add seeds or nuts for extra crunch and nutrition

On average, one wrap provides about 350–450 calories depending on fillings and sauce quantity — making it a satisfying yet balanced meal option.

FAQs

Q1: Can I make these wraps ahead of time?

A1: Yes, assemble them up to a day in advance and store tightly wrapped in plastic or foil in the refrigerator. For the freshest texture, keep sauce and vegetables separate until just before eating.

Q2: What’s the best chicken to use?

A2: Grilled or shredded rotisserie chicken is perfect. You can also use air-fried tenders, breaded chicken cutlets, or even leftover BBQ chicken.

Q3: Is sweet chili sauce spicy?

A3: It has mild heat balanced by sweetness. For less spice, dilute it with a bit of Greek yogurt or mayo. For more heat, add Sriracha or chili flakes.

Q4: Can I make these vegetarian?

A4: Absolutely. Use grilled tofu, tempeh, or chickpeas tossed in sweet chili sauce as a substitute for chicken.

Q5: What type of wrap works best?

A5: Large, soft flour tortillas are easiest to roll. You can also use whole wheat, spinach, or gluten-free options based on dietary needs.

Q6: How do I stop the wrap from falling apart?

A6: Don’t overfill, warm the tortilla first, and make sure wet ingredients (like sauce) are spread in moderation. Wrap tightly and rest seam-side down.

Q7: Can I freeze sweet chili chicken wraps?

A7: It’s not recommended. The fresh veggies lose their texture when frozen and thawed. For freezer prep, freeze only the cooked chicken and assemble wraps fresh.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ups cooked chicken (shredded or diced)

  • 1/3 cup sweet chili sauce

  • 4 large flour tortillas

  • 1 cup shredded lettuce or spinach

  • 1/2 cup julienned carrots

  • 1/2 red bell pepper, thinly sliced

  • 1/2 cucumber, julienned

  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ro (optional)

  • 1/4 cup plain Greek yogurt or mayo (optional)

Instructions

  1. Toss the cooked chicken in sweet chili sauce and set aside.

  2. Warm tortillas slightly for easier rolling.

  3. Spread a thin layer of yogurt or mayo on each tortilla.

  4. Add a scoop of chicken and top with vegetables and cilantro.

  5. Roll tightly, fold in sides, and slice in half if desired.

  6. Serve immediately or chill for up to 1 day.
